Definition

A terrapin is a small freshwater turtle that lives in ponds, lakes, or slow rivers.

Usage & Nuances

'Terrapin' is mostly used in British English; in the US, 'turtle' or 'slider' is more common. It refers specifically to certain small freshwater turtles, not all turtles or tortoises. Often found in pet contexts or discussing native wildlife.
